Hi brianfromhayling island. If your iPad has an automatically downloaded update, you should find it in Settings > General > Storage & iCloud Usage > STORAGE Manage Storage. Note that this is the first Manage Storage. It lists the device storage used by all the apps. The update file should be pretty large, so it will be near the top of the list. Tap on it to get the delete option.

I've been following your steps (I get the same exact error message about being connected to the internet). When I go into my usage and manage, it has iOS 10.2.1 listed. Would I follow those same steps in deleting it and checking for updates after that?
Hi Jdguddat. Yes. You can only install the current iOS version for the device, 10.3.2 in your case. The older version downloaded will not be verified by Apple. The message is misleading, since it assumes that verification failure must mean that the internet connection has failed. You need to delete the old download and check for updates again. If you're updating from a much older iOS version, you may need to use iTunes on a computer, particularly if storage is tight. Are you using a VPN, unblocker, or special DNS service? Are you using DNS consistent with your location, likely from your internet provider? It sounds like the updater is failing to connect to the server. Also, be sure your device has enough free storage. 5 gig shoild be plenty.
